A Message from the Executive Director

January 22, 2026

In early January, my workout instructor mentioned that January is a great time for reflection about the previous year prior to setting intentions and goals for the new year. That advice resonated so much with me that I had our staff reflect on the highs and lows of 2025. Not surprisingly, we all thought that our family programming went well, we successfully provided $1000 higher ed scholarships to six amazing students who overcame pediatric cancer, the emergency financial assistance program ran smoothly, and newly diagnosed families found a warm and loving community to help them navigate a pediatric cancer diagnosis.

On the community outreach and fundraising front, our incredibly successful collaboration with the Portland Thorns, WCP Cares, Thursday Night Motocross and The Portland Montessori School, along with our fundraisers and silent auctions helped to spread the word about Candlelighters to the broader Portland community as well as raising the funds needed to fuel our work.

In terms of lows, we were saddened to pause our peer-to-peer parent mentorship program due funding not being renewed. It was also a year in which some Candlelighters families experienced the loss of their loved one; to all of our bereaved families we wish you much strength during such difficult times.

Looking ahead, there is exciting, new programming planned for 2026! We have launched our Home to Hospital Care Bag initiative offering to-go bags for families that suddenly face unexpected long hospital stays. Social workers and life child specialists at Doernbecher and Randall Children’s hospitals are very excited about this new initiative just like we are! To find out about how you can help, please visit our Amazon wishlist. We are also planning our first mom’s retreat which will take place in Hood River in April. We know this will provide a space for healing that our mothers desperately need.
